**TICKET-4471: Signature check failing on sqlint bundle**

Hey all — the new SQL linting rules package (no trailing semicolons, uppercase keywords, mandatory table aliases) won't install because the artifact signature check fails on the Quarrow CI runners. Looks like the runners still have last quarter's key cached. Bundle itself is fine; I rebuilt it twice. To unblock, add the current signing key to the runner trust store.

rollout seal: bky4_DFM9

// Release notes for the Larkspur password-reset revamp.
// We replaced the single-use token scheme with a rotating
// nonce chain and added per-account throttling to blunt
// enumeration attacks. Token lifetime, hash cost, and retry
// windows were tuned against the staging traffic replay from
// the Meridian launch. Changing any of these requires a joint
// sign-off from security and the release manager, since they
// affect lockout behavior in production. The values currently
// approved for this release are declared immediately below.

tuning constants:
BUDGETS = {
    "druath": 240,
    "lamwyn": 180,
    "silael": 275,
}

Subject: Websocket compression defaults in Rillgate 3.1

New folks: per-message deflate is now on by default for Rillgate websocket connections. Tradeoffs: ~60% bandwidth savings on JSON-heavy streams, but roughly 300 KB extra memory per connection and measurable CPU on the edge tier. High-fanout services should disable it via config; low-traffic dashboards should leave it on. Benchmarks are on the wiki. All numbers were collected against the build identified by the token below.

pipeline stamp: htk21_86b657ac0aa916a9af17f

Subject: On-call primer — Ledgerlens audit-log viewer

Welcome to the rotation. Ledgerlens pages are usually ingestion lag, not data loss; the viewer buffers events for up to an hour. If lag exceeds that, restart the indexer first, then check retention jobs. Escalate only if queries return partial results after recovery. Runbooks, dashboards, and the escalation rota for new team members are collected on the internal page below.

operations page: https://jenkins.xolmarsys.corp/repo